
/* These styles were generated from the Theme Builder in the site admin. */

#header .container, #footer .container { max-width: 800px; }

body { background: #041527;  }

/* Header */
#header { background: #041527; }

#header h1 a { display: block; width: 185px; height: 80px; background: url(https://pigeon-au.s3.us-west-or.io.cloud.ovh.us/6390e5db7808d527c7a795f62975148c.png) no-repeat center; background-size: 100% auto; text-indent: -9999px; }

@media only screen and (max-width: 520px) {
	#header h1 a { width: 85%; height: auto; max-height: 110px; aspect-ratio: 480 / 199; background-size: contain; margin: 0 auto; }
	#header #account-header {  margin-top: 15px; }
}

/* Main Headings */
.option-heading { background: #F02F20; }

/* Sub Text */
.main-content a:not(.button), .subscription-options .signup .info p, .agreement, .agreement a, .cnd-user-orders #order-detail .name, .default-more-plans, .homepage .plans-selection-box p { color: #F02F20; }

/* Error Message */
.error-message {  }

/* Buttons */
.button, .ui-dialog .ui-dialog-buttonset button {
  background: #FFF20D;
  box-shadow: inset 0px 1px 0px #fff764, 0px 1px 3px rgba(0, 0, 0, 0.4), inset 0 -10px 20px rgba(0, 0, 0, 0.1), inset 0px 10px 20px rgba(255, 255, 255, 0.1);
  border: 1px solid #c0b500;
  border-top-color: #d9cd00;
  border-bottom-color: #a69d00;
  /* color: #000 !important; */
}
.button:hover, .ui-dialog .ui-dialog-buttonset button:hover {
  background: #e8dc00;
  box-shadow: inset 0px 1px 3px rgba(0, 0, 0, 0.4), inset 0px 1px 0px #fff540, inset 0 -10px 20px rgba(0, 0, 0, 0.1), inset 0px 10px 20px rgba(255, 255, 255, 0.1);
  border-color: #9c9300;
  border-top-color: #b5ac00;
  border-bottom-color: #827b00;
  /* color: #000 !important; */
}

/* Checkboxes */
.checkbox > input:checked + .checkbox-placeholder { 
  background-color: #FFF20D;
  border-color: #c0b500;
  border-top-color: #d9cd00;
  border-bottom-color: #a69d00;
  box-shadow: inset 0px 1px 1px #fff764, inset 0px -1px 1px rgba(0, 0, 0, 0.1), inset 0px 5px 8px rgba(255, 255, 255, 0.1);
}
.checkbox > input:hover:checked + .checkbox-placeholder { border-color: #FFF20D; }

/* Radios */
/* .radio > input:checked + .radio-placeholder,
.radio.radio--fake .radio-placeholder { background-color: #FFF20D; border-color: #FFF20D; }
.radio > input:hover:checked + .radio-placeholder { border-color: #FFF20D; } */

/* Footer */
#footer { background: #2B2B2B; }

/* Date Picker */
.datepick-nav { background: #FFF20D !important; }
.datepick-nav a { color: #000 !important; }
.datepick-cmd:hover { background-color: rgba(255,255,255,0.2) !important; box-shadow: 0 0 2px rgba(0,0,0,0.2); }
.datepick-month-header, .datepick-ctrl { background-color: #474747 !important; }
.datepick-month td .datepick-highlight, .datepick-month td .datepick-selected { background: #FFF20D !important; color: #000 !important; }

/* Advanced Theme Settings - Custom CSS */
body, h1, h2, h3, h4, h5, h6 { color: #ffffff;}

#action-login, .option-heading {text-transform: uppercase;}
#login .login-block {padding: 30px 30px 40px 30px;}
#login .login-block, .subscription-options .signup, .login-banner-prompt, .main-content .block, .description
 {background: #1a3756 !important;}
#login A.forgot, .subscription-options .signup h3, .subscription-options .signup .info ul li, .subscription-options .signup .term, .subscription-options, .page-title h1 {color: #ffffff;}
#login A.forgot {font-size: 18px; text-decoration: none; padding-top: 10px;}
.button.green, .subscription-options .signup .zip-check a.button {border-radius: 79px; text-transform: uppercase; color: #041527;}
.subscription-term-detail::before{content:'' !important;}
.subscription-term-detail{display:block !important; font-style:italic; font-weight:normal;}
.main-content a:not(.button), .subscription-options .signup .info p, p.agreement, p.agreement a, .cnd-user-orders #order-detail .name, .default-more-plans, .homepage .plans-selection-box p {color: #ffe318;}
.button:not(.disabled) {text-shadow: unset; color: #000;}
.vo-form-subscription-summary,
.vo-form-subscription-summary h2,
.choose-plans,
.choose-plans.two-plans h2 { color: initial; }
.vo-payment-request-button:after { opacity: 0.3; }
.vo-payment-request-button .or-use-wallet { background: #1a3756 !important; color: #778da7; }
.main-content .block .slider { background: #1a3756 !important; }

.change-subscription .choose-plans h2 { color: #333; }

/* Forgot Password */
.page-title {background-color: #f02f20; padding: 15px 30px;}
.page-title h1 {font-weight: 600;}
.page-title, .main-content .block, .subscription-options .signup {border-color: #224469;}
.button.blue.submit.login {color: #041527; text-transform: uppercase;}
